Introduction to Wikidot
Wikidot is an open-source platform designed for creating and managing collaborative websites. It combines the flexibility of a wiki with the structure of a traditional content management system (CMS). Unlike many other platforms, Wikidot allows users to create multiple websites under a single account, making it ideal for managing projects, teams, or communities.
One of the standout features of Wikidot is its simplicity. Even users without technical expertise can create professional-looking websites using pre-designed templates and intuitive tools. At the same time, advanced users can leverage Wikidot’s extensive customization options to build highly tailored solutions.

History and Evolution of Wikidot
Wikidot was launched in 2006 by a team of developers who wanted to create a platform that combined the collaborative nature of wikis with the versatility of a CMS. Over the years, Wikidot has grown significantly, attracting users from diverse backgrounds, including education, business, and non-profit organizations.
The platform’s evolution has been marked by continuous improvements and updates. Key milestones include the introduction of new templates, enhanced security features, and integration with third-party tools. Today, Wikidot serves millions of users worldwide, hosting thousands of websites across various niches.

Community and Collaboration on Wikidot
One of Wikidot’s standout features is its emphasis on community and collaboration. Here’s how it fosters teamwork:
Real-Time Editing
Multiple users can edit the same page simultaneously, with changes reflected in real time. This feature is particularly useful for team projects.
Version Control
Wikidot keeps track of all changes made to a page, allowing users to revert to previous versions if needed. This ensures that no work is lost during the editing process.
